Early Years Apprenticeship Level 2 B709E

To learn responsibility for the display and maintenance of a safe, stimulating, interactive, learning environment in the Nursery.

To learn to work within the guidelines of the Early Years Foundation Stage and assist in the planning, preparation and delivery of an effective programme of activities to help babies and young children to develop.

To learn the implementation of providing stimulating learning experiences, which enable young children to grow in confidence and independence.

To learn and develop skills to effectively observe, assess, monitoring and record children’s learning and development using a variety of methods. To gather these observations and produce individual profiles for each child in your small key worker group. To learn responsibility for providing full access to an effective programme of activities for children identified as requiring additional support. To participate in staff meetings. To provide cover for practitioners within the team as necessary. To work in partnership with other professionals involved with the children and their families, i.e. health visitors, Inclusion support, speech therapists. To support in the care of sick children and those suffering minor injury. To be familiar with the fire drill and procedures for the safety of the children. To assist with checking equipment for safety and suitability to use and preparing resources as appropriate. To share responsibility for ensuring the room is cleaned at the end of each day. To assist in the identification of child protection issues. To access personal and curriculum development opportunities. To undertake duties in such a way that ensures a positive multi-cultural approval and with full regard for the principles and policies in place at the YMCA and comply with the Equal Opportunities & Diversity Policy and Child Protection Procedures within the organisat Operate within YMCA policies and procedures, strictly observing Health & Safety regulations of colleagues, parents/carers and yourself and the Safeguarding Children & Young People Policy. Operate within Nursery policies and procedures. Ensure all work practice is inclusive, expressed through a wholehearted commitment to welcome those of all faiths and none. Undertake any other related duties that are consistent with the job.

Training:

Early Years Practitioner Level 2

Functional Skills English and Maths if required

Blended on/off the job training and location to be confirmed



Training Outcome:

Possible permanent position at the end of apprenticeship. Possible chance of moving on to further qualifications.
